Despite the horrible weather, I was so happy with the turnout for the private view of my solo show, Tabletop Tales . It turned into a wonderful evening filled with interesting conversations, drinks flowing, and smiles all around. The exhibition brings together a selection of still life paintings I’ve been working on over the past few months, and it was such a pleasure to finally share them and see people engaging with the work.

Second Prize
Last November I was honoured and thrilled to receive second prize at the Beverley Annual Open Exhibition. A big thank you to the guest selectors and to the Friends of Beverley Art Group for organising such a wonderful event. I really enjoyed the presentation evening and the opportunity to meet and get to know other local artists—it made the experience even more special.
